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 18031 zip code. The total population is 11882, of which, 5582 are male and 6300 are female. With a total area of 35.371 square miles, the population density is 300.3 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 37.2 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 18031 zip code is $111090. This is 24.79% greater than the national average. This income places 4.2%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$21503. Education

In the 18031 zip code, 95%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 51.6%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 18031 zip, there are an estimated 6004 people in the labor force, of which, 5712 are employed, and 292 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 29.2 minutes. Of the total people that work, 704 worked from home and 5429 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 39.6. Housing

The median home value for the 18031 zip code is 294500. There is an estimated  4078 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1577 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1615.
